Prefabrication and Modular Construction

Prefabricated or offsite construction means building elements are manufactured away from the construction site before being delivered to and assembled on-site. This type of construction is not new, but it is seeing a resurgence due to the many advantages it offers, including the following.

   •   Faster construction times: Because the building components are factory-made, they can be assembled much more quickly on-site as opposed to traditional construction methods.

   •   Reduced waste: Offsite construction results in less waste on-site.

   •   Lowered labor costs: Using prefabricated components reduces the amount of manual labor needed on-site. This is a timely construction industry trend, as there is a shortage of workers in the construction industry.         

   •   Reduced environmental impact: Construction off site results in less dust, noise, and pollution on-site.

How AI is Transforming New Home Construction

From streamlining data organization and procurement to enabling design modifications and smart home automation, artificial intelligence (AI) is becoming an invaluable asset for home builders. While AI presents endless possibilities across various industries, the construction sector is actively leveraging these capabilities to address common challenges faced by builders. Whether it’s managing paperwork, securing material bids, or refining design plans, innovative startups are providing AI-driven solutions to ease everyday stressors in the industry.

Despite AI’s potential, a human touch remains crucial to developing these technologies and ensuring their successful implementation. Here’s a look at how AI is enhancing the new-home construction process for builders and their teams.

Creating a Digital Blueprint of the Home

For homebuyers, purchasing a home is a significant investment, and having a clear, organized build process is essential. AI helps by processing and organizing complex build documentation—such as selections and change orders—to create a detailed and accurate digital representation of the home. This AI-powered file management and collaboration system enables builders to work more efficiently and provides homeowners with a highly organized, interactive digital copy of their home. Users can even associate files with specific spaces on a floor plan, making selections easier to manage for each room.

Optimizing Bidding and Sourcing

AI-driven procurement software can revolutionize the bidding and sourcing process, helping builders gather bids, source materials, and connect with niche suppliers, including those that are sustainable, minority-owned, woman-owned, or veteran-owned. This software allows builders to order materials on a predictive schedule and make change orders seamlessly, contributing to a “healthier and happier industry.”

Enhancing Customer Support and Sales

AI is also transforming customer service and sales in new-home construction. AI-powered chatbots provide 24/7 assistance, answering questions from prospective buyers at any stage of their journey. These chatbots, or digital assistants, are often more engaging than live chat solutions, with homebuyers being two to three times more likely to interact with them for immediate answers to their queries.

Simplifying Interior Design Decisions

AI-powered tools are making it easier to envision future interior design projects. Builders and architects can use AI to brainstorm design ideas quickly and efficiently. By combining AI modeling and algorithms, these tools can generate unique interior design images based on user-uploaded photos in seconds. This feature serves as a valuable collaboration tool between builders, designers, and clients, allowing them to experiment with various layouts and see how different designs could transform a space.

Automating Smart Home Technology

As smart-home solutions become a standard feature in new-build packages, AI is playing a crucial role in advancing home automation. AI and machine learning are paving the way for more intuitive and adaptive smart-home systems that go beyond manual programming. These next-generation solutions will offer true home automation by learning and adapting to a homeowner’s habits, usage patterns, and preferences. From video analytics and integrated lighting systems to irrigation and energy management, AI is simplifying daily tasks and helping create a truly connected and integrated home environment.

SIPs – state-of-the-art building envelopes

15X more airtight than standard stick framed HOMES

What are SIP’s?

Structural insulated panels (SIPs) are a high-performance building system used in residential and light commercial construction. These panels consist of an insulating foam core sandwiched between two structural facings, typically made of oriented strand board (OSB). Manufactured under controlled factory conditions, SIPs can be customized to fit almost any building design, resulting in a construction system that is exceptionally strong, energy-efficient, and cost-effective.

Outstanding Thermal Performance

SIPs provide superior insulation and airtightness, significantly reducing energy costs over the building’s lifetime. They are approximately 50% more energy-efficient than traditional timber framing. The SIP building envelope minimizes thermal bridging and offers excellent airtightness, making it ideal for LEED and net-zero-ready building standards.

Healthier Indoor Air Quality

Buildings constructed with SIPs offer better control over indoor air quality due to the airtight envelope, which restricts incoming air to controlled ventilation, filtering out contaminants and allergens. Unlike conventional stick framing, SIPs have no voids or thermal bridging that can lead to condensation and potentially hazardous mold, mildew, or rot.

Sustainable and Eco-Friendly

SIPs contribute positively to the environment by reducing CO2 emissions due to their high energy efficiency. They also require significantly less energy during the manufacturing process compared to traditional construction methods and have a lower embodied energy than conventional materials like steel, concrete, and masonry.

Faster Construction with Reduced Labor

SIP walls and roofs are designed and precisely manufactured offsite, enabling quick assembly and making the building watertight in just a few days. This accelerates the construction process and reduces costs associated with project management, scaffolding, and labor. A BASF time-motion study found that SIP panels can reduce jobsite labor requirements by 55%.

Design Flexibility

SIPs can be engineered and fabricated to accommodate any building design, providing architects and builders with the flexibility to create aesthetically pleasing and innovative spaces.
